The Battle of the Mind: Feelings Versus Faith

Many believers characterize their faith by how they feel.  God gave us emotions, to exhilarate, warn, direct and inspire us. However, we must always examine our feelings based on the state of our heart, which can be tainted by our sin nature.  Emotions/feelings can come from the enemy, and mislead us.   Let’s learn to control our soul realm (feelings/emotions) so that we think and act in line with God; not the enemy.
